See the License for the specific language governing permissions and limitations under the License. */ package com.linkedin.r2.filter; import com.linkedin.r2.filter.message.rest.RestFilter; import com.linkedin.r2.filter.message.stream.StreamFilter; import com.linkedin.r2.message.RequestContext; import com.linkedin.r2.message.rest.RestRequest; import com.linkedin.r2.message.rest.RestResponse; import com.linkedin.r2.message.stream.StreamRequest; import com.linkedin.r2.message.stream.StreamResponse; import java.util.Map; /** * A chain of {@link RestFilter}s and {@link StreamFilter}s that get a chance to process or modify the request/response, * wire attributes, and local attributes. The {@link RestFilter}s would only be applied to rest request/response. The * {@link StreamFilter}s would only be applied to stream request/response. <p/> * * <dl> * <dt>Immutability</dt> * <dd> * Filter chains are immutable. Adding a new filter does not change the filter chain but * instead produces a copy of the filter chain with the new filter inserted. * </dd> * * <dt>Filter Order</dt> * <dd> * Requests are processed starting from the beginning of the chain and move towards the end of * the filter chain. Responses are processed from the end of the filter chain and move back * towards the beginning of the filter chain.<p/> * * If a request filter throws an exception, calls {@code nextFilter.onResponse(...)}, or * calls {@code nextFilter.onError(..)} then that filter will have the appropriate response * method invoked (onResponse or onError). The response will flow back towards the beginning * of the filter chain. Filters later in the chain will not get a change to process the * request or the response. * </dd> * * <dt>Wire Attributes</dt> * <dd> * Wire attributes provide a mechanism for sending request or response metadata to the remote * endpoint. As an example, this facility can be used to send a unique request identifier from * a client to a server. * </dd> * * <dt>Local Attributes</dt> * <dd> * Filters must be stateless, so local attributes provide a mechanism for saving some state * during the request which can be used during response processing.
